Background
- Scope and content:
-
The collection includes memorabilia and ephemera related mostly to Alice's Adventures in Wonderland, but also includes items related to Alice Through the Looking Glass. The collection also includes papers, correspondence and photos related to Carol's membership in the Lewis Carroll Society of North America.
- Biographical / historical:
-
Carol Elizabeth Stoops Droessler graduated from Longwood College in 1950. While attending Longwood Carol was a member of the Rotunda Staff, Dramatic Club, Newman Club and Cotillion Club. She married Earl Droessler in the 1950s. Throughout her life, Carol was interested in Lewis Carroll's Alice books. She collected published editions of his books, memorabilia and ephemera of Lewis Carroll and Alice. She joined the Lewis Carroll Society of North America in the late 1980s, and attended meetings of the organization and participated in tours and lectures.
- Custodial history:
-
Items were collected by Carol Droessler who made plans to donate the collection to Longwood in April 1998. Her husband Earl Droessler officially donated the collection to Greenwood Library after her death in 1998.
